We are so excited to celebrate with you on the Amalfi Coast! Our wedding will take place in Amalfi, Italy at Villa Vettica, perched above the sea with breathtaking views of the coastline. Amalfi is a charming, walkable town, but be prepared for plenty of steps, winding paths, and hills - comfortable shoes are a must. Ride-share services like Uber/Lyft are not available, but taxis, ferries, and private car services are readily accessible and make getting around easy. There are multiple international airports that service the region, with Naples being the most common gateway, followed by Rome, as well as a smaller regional option. Amalfi and the surrounding towns offer a wide range of beautiful accommodations, from boutique hotels to seaside villas. Rome Fiumicino "Leonardo da Vinci" Airport (FCO)

Rome Fiumicino Airport is another option for traveling to the Amalfi Coast, though it is farther than Naples and requires additional travel time. From Rome, guests can take a high-speed train to Naples (approximately 1 hour and 10 minutes) and then continue on to Amalfi by private car or ferry. Alternatively, you may choose to arrange a direct car service from the Rome airport straight to your hotel along the coast.

Salerno Costa d’Amalfi Airport (QSR)

Salerno Costa d’Amalfi Airport is a smaller regional airport and a convenient option for reaching the Amalfi Coast when available. From Salerno, Amalfi is approximately 1–1.5 hours away by car, and guests can also continue their journey via ferry along the coast, depending on schedules. Flight options may be more limited than Naples or Rome, but it can be a great alternative for those able to route through it.
